Um capitão de cruzeiro coreano, uma mocinha atrapalhada e traída quando faltava apenas uma semana para o casamento. Márcia viaja sozinha para aproveitar o cruzeiro de sua lua de mel que nunca aconteceu, após ser traída pelo noivo com quem estava há 10 anos. Mal sabe ela que o capitão do navio, Park, um coreano com um passado obscuro, a conquistaria de um jeito tão avassalador.
